    The authors consider self-similar measures \(\mu_{M,D}\) generated by iterated function systems consisting of maps of the form \(\phi_d:\mathbb{R}^n\to \mathbb{R}^n\), \(x\mapsto M^{-1}(x+d)\), where \(M\) is an expanding real \(n\times n\) matrix and \(d\in D\), for some finite digit set \(D\subset \mathbb{Z}^d\). Necessary and sufficient conditions on \(D\) are derived so that \(L^2(\mu_{M,D})\) admits an infinite orthogonal set of exponential functions. Moreover, necessary and sufficient conditions for \(L^2(\mu_{M,D})\) to have a Fourier basis are given. Examples illustrating the results are also provided.
